STEPHENS, Gregory P., age 66, of Oregonia, passed away Thurs. Aug. 22, 2019 at Clinton Memorial Hospital.

An electrician, Greg retired in 2015 after 30 years of service from Commercial Electrician Local 648 IBEW in Hamilton. He was a member of the Montgomery Masonic Lodge #94 and the Scottish Rite Valley of Cincinnati.

Fun-loving, easygoing, kind-hearted, and always willing to help others, Greg was a great father to his son and husband to his wife. He admired old cars and enjoyed attending old car shows. Some years ago, he restored a '66 Mustang and was currently in the process of restoring a '55 Chevy. He also enjoyed shooting pool, wagering at the horse and dog tracks, hanging out with his friends, and especially his biannual vacations to Ormond Beach in Florida. He will also be remembered for his Fedora hat collection, his enjoyment for playing the guitar, and his festive love of the Christmas season-complete with a red hat and ugly sweater.

He was preceded in death by his parents Bernard and Lessie Mae Stephens; one brother Ray Stephens Jr., sister-in-law Sue Stephens, and brother-in-law Barry Pottorf. He is survived by his wife of 49 years, Brenda; two sons Eric (Kelly) Stephens and Justin Stephens (fiancee Rochelle); four grandchildren Shelby, Ryan, Devan, and Cheyenne; two brothers Keith Stephens and Steve (Yvonne) Stephens; sister Janet Pottorf; and several nieces and nephews.

Private family services will be held at Stubbs-Conner Funeral Home in Waynesville. Full Masonic and Scottish Rite services will be conducted during the services. Burial will be in Miami Cemetery, Corwin.
